Scientists invent a gel that creates neurons from other cells, which could help treat Alzheimer's

Scientists invent a gel that creates neurons from other cells, which could help treat Alzheimer'sWorldPing

Scientists found a way to convert brain cells called astrocytes into neurons. In theory, this could replenish neurons lost in neurodegenerative conditions like Alzheimer's disease.
